How to Successfully Navigate CV and Interview Selection Processes

As part of the job selection process, applicants must undergo several stages, from administrative screening to interviews. However, many people struggle or repeatedly fail at a particular stage, which can lead to discouragement and self-doubt.

Lisa Qonita, Senior Vice President of People and Culture at Indosat Ooredoo Hutchison (IOH), shared various tips and tricks related to the recruitment process during the Career Preparation Talkshow, part of the INSPIRE Career Week 2025 held on Friday (May 23, 2025), at FEB UGM. Lisa emphasized the importance of having a clear value proposition and your unique strengths and skills, as clearly stated in your curriculum vitae (CV). In addition, she advised including key achievements and complete personal information such as phone number, LinkedIn profile link, and the most recent educational background.

She noted that a strong CV aligns with the position being applied for. Therefore, she advised candidates to tailor their CVs for each job application to help recruiters assess how well they fit the role. In addition to content, the design of the CV should be professional and easy to read. It is best to avoid excessive use of colors, irrelevant graphics, and fonts that are too small or difficult to read.

Once applicants pass the administrative selection, the next challenge is the job interview. This is where candidates are expected to present who they are and explain why they are a good fit for the company. Lisa advised against memorizing answers from the internet. While using online responses as references is acceptable, they should be adapted to reflect one’s personal experience and skills to avoid sounding rigid or overly generic.

Candidates are encouraged to be proactive and structure their answers clearly during interviews. When answering questions, Lisa recommended using the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, and Result). Additionally, applicants must research the company’s role and industry before the interview. Even better, she added, if applicants can offer insights or solutions to potential challenges faced by the company.

Throughout the interview process, attitude also plays an important role. Candidates should demonstrate enthusiasm, remain courteous, and avoid giving off an impression of disinterest or laziness. Furthermore, their motivation for applying should not solely focus on learning but on what value and contributions they can bring to the company.

At the end of the session, Lisa reminded participants to maintain a positive mindset. She pointed out that one’s attitude and thinking play a significant role in influencing the outcome. While a CV opens the door to opportunities, candidates ultimately succeed based on how they present their attitude, narrative, and responses during the interview. She encouraged applicants to approach each stage of the recruitment process with complete preparation and intention.
